Drugs at the wheel: Police caught drivers with fake urine!

On Tuesday, June 3, the police carried out stationary traffic controls in Korbach and Twistetal. Under the motto "Alcohol and drugs in road traffic", the measures were all about traffic safety. The officers felt two drivers who were under the influence of drugs. Particularly spectacular: One of the perpetrators tried to deceive control with "fake urine", but the police remained suspicious and carried out another test-which was clearly positive for cannabis. During the subsequent search of the vehicle, the police found the fake urine.

In addition, the officers discovered false license plates on a vehicle and started the trail of two drivers without a valid driving license. The controllers were mostly received positively by the road users. The police warn: the effect of drugs is often underestimated, and those who have consumed should do without driving for several days. In view of the numerous suspicious drivers who have not yet noticed, the police are planning further controls to combat alcohol and drug offenses in road traffic.
